4
INSPECT ABS WHEEL-SPEED SENSOR
CIRCUIT FOR SHORT TO GROUND
• Turn ignition key to OFF.
• Disconnect ABS (ABS/TCS) HU/CM and
wheel-speed sensor connectors.
• Inspect continuity between suspected sensor
terminal(s) of ABS (ABS/TCS) HU/CM
connector (harness side) and ground(s).
— RF wheel-speed sensor: G—ground
— LF wheel-speed sensor: I—ground
— RR wheel-speed sensor: A—ground
— LR wheel-speed sensor: C—ground
• Is there continuity?
Yes
Repair or replace harness for short to ground circuit
between ABS (ABS/TCS) HU/CM and ABC wheel-sped
sensor, then go to Step 9.
No
Go to next step.
5
INSPECT WHEEL-SPEED SENSOR
• Turn ignition key to OFF.
• Disconnect suspected wheel-speed sensor
connector(s) and inspect resistance between
wheel-speed sensor terminal(s) (part side).
• Is resistance within 1.3—1.7 kilohm?
Yes
Go to next step.
No
Replace wheel-speed sensor(s), then go to Step 9.
6
INSPECT SENSOR ROTOR CLEARANCE
• Jack-up vehicle and support it with safety
stands.
• Remove suspected wheel(s).
• Inspect clearance between wheel-speed
sensor and sensor rotor.
• Is clearance within 0.3—1.1 mm {0.012—
0.043 in}?
Yes
Go to next step.
No
Replace wheel-speed sensor(s), then go to Step 9.
7
INSPECT SENSOR ROTOR FOR DAMAGE
• Jack-up vehicle and support it with safety
stands.
• Remove suspected wheel(s).
• Visually inspect sensor rotor for missing,
deformed and obstructed teeth.
Number of teeth: 44
• Is sensor rotor okay?
Yes
Go to next step.
No
Replace sensor rotor, then go to Step 9.

DTC
C1186, C1266
Fail-safe relay
DETECTION
CONDITION
• C1186:
— Fail-safe relay in ABS (ABS/TCS) HU/CM stuck OFF when ignition switch is turned ON, fail-safe
relay ON is commanded.
• C1266:
— Fail-safe relay in ABS (ABS/TCS) HU/CM stuck ON when ignition switch is turned ON, fail-safe relay
OFF is commanded.
POSSIBLE
CAUSE
• Malfunction of fuse (ABS 60 A)
• Open circuit in harness between ABS (ABS/TCS) HU/CM terminal AA and battery positive terminal
• Open or short of fail-safe relay in ABS (ABS/TCS) HU/CM
• Stuck fail-safe relay in ABS (ABS/TCS) HU/CM

DTC C1194, C1198, C1210, C1214, C1242, C1246, C1250, C1254
A6E697567650W13
Diagnostic procedure
STEP
INSPECTION
ACTION
1
INSPECT ABS FUSE CONDITION
• Is ABS fuse (60 A) okay?
Yes
Go to next step.
No
Replace fuse, then go to Step 4.
2
INSPECT FAIL-SAFE RELAY POWER
SUPPLY CIRCUIT FOR OPEN CIRCUIT
• Turn ignition key to OFF.
• Disconnect ABS (ABS/TCS) HU/CM
connector.
• Connect SST (adapter harness) to ABS (ABS/
TCS) HU/CM connector (harness side only).
• Turn ignition key to ON (engine OFF).
• Measure voltage between ABS (ABS/TCS)
HU/CM terminal AA (harness side) of SST
and ground.
• Is voltage B+?
Yes
Go to next step.
No
Repair or replace harness for open circuit between battery
positive terminal and ABS (ABS/TCS) HU/CM terminal AA,
then go to Step 4.
3
VERIFY FAIL-SAFE OPERATION
• Turn ignition key to OFF.
• Remove SST (adapter harness) and connect
all disconnected connectors.
• Connect WDS or equivalent to DLC-2.
• Turn ignition key to ON (engine OFF).
• Access ABS_VOLT using WDS or
equivalent.
• Does fail-safe relay operate?
Yes
Go to next step.
No
Replace ABS (ABS/TCS) HU/CM, then go to next step.

DETECTION
CONDITION
• Solenoid monitor signal does not track in response to solenoid ON/OFF command.
POSSIBLE
CAUSE
• Open, short to power, or short to ground circuit in ABS (ABS/TCS) HU/CM
• Stuck solenoid valve in ABS (ABS/TCS) HU/CM
